The logistics industry is on the cusp of a revolution driven by autonomous vehicles, consisting of drones and self-driving vehicles. These modern technologies assure to change exactly how products are carried and supplied, using considerable benefits but also presenting numerous obstacles that need to be attended to.

The Improvement With Autonomous Vehicles

Autonomous transportation technology is positioned to change the area of enhancing the pace, performance, and financial practicality of moving items. Driverless vehicles can work continuously without breaks, bring about significant decreases in delivery periods. On the other hand, drones offer swift distribution choices that are especially valuable in city setups for covering short distances.

Advantages of Autonomous Cars in Logistics

1. By embracing independent automobiles, companies can dramatically minimize their logistics expenditures by decreasing labor-related expenses. With a reduced need for human motorists, companies can allot less resources in the direction of worker compensation, advantages, and training programs. Additionally, the nonstop operation of vehicles all the time enables firms to optimize their asset performance and get one of the most out of their fleet.
2. Enhanced Performance: Self-driving cars have the capacity to efficiently intend and change courses on-the-go to prevent traffic jams and minimize fuel. This leads to lowered operational costs and less injury to the environment. Drones supply a fast and reliable shipment remedy by flying over road blockage.
3. Enhanced Safety: In the logistics market, accidents typically take place because of human blunders. Autonomous lorries, which are equipped with sophisticated technology like sensing units and AI, have the possible to reduce the chance of accidents. By keeping steady rates, adhering to web traffic laws rigorously, and responding promptly to risks, independent cars can boost safety substantially contrasted to human chauffeurs.
4. Scalability is significantly enhanced in logistics procedures with the use of self-governing lorries. Businesses have the versatility to expand their transportation capabilities without being limited by workforce restrictions, which is specifically advantageous during active periods of high demand.

Obstacles Facing Autonomous Automobiles in Logistics

1. Challenges in Laws: The regulations governing self-governing automobiles are continually changing. Different nations and locations have various legal requirements, making it challenging for organizations that function across borders. Satisfying the criteria and receiving permission for self-governing features can take a considerable amount of time and money.
2. Security Worries: Regardless of the potential for improved security, self-governing automobiles are not entirely faultless. The danger of mechanical failures, hacking, and unforeseen dangers continues to be a substantial concern. To guarantee the reliability and safety of these systems, detailed testing and robust cybersecurity protocols are important.
3. Innovation restrictions: Although independent automobiles use innovative modern technology, it is not remarkable. Damaging climate can influence sensing units, and browsing with elaborate city settings can be difficult. Continuous improvements and imaginative remedies are critical to get over these obstacles.
4. Public Acceptance: The acceptance of autonomous vehicles by the public and by industry professionals is a considerable barrier. Issues regarding task losses, security, and the dependability of these systems require to be attended to with transparent communication, education, and demonstration of the advantages and integrity of independent modern technology.
